A friend of mine bought this cadillac for $550....someone messed with it the the point where i replaced the wiring harness behind the dashboard for the speedo/climate/fuel/stereo etc. I also at the same time had to convert from analog to digital because of the wiring difference. That all works all done. Pulled the heater fan out to bench test and it shorts. I also replaced the A/C power module with a used one, now new fan works. The F32 code ive never dealt with but I know that it means communication error between ECM & BCM. I don't have an FSM for the 89' with TBI.. The original (I'd like to think) BCM fried after buddy jump started the fuel and climate went out. I had a spare BCM lying around from a 4.5 PFI/4.9PFI car so I tried it. Seems to have worked other than F32. Went and got another BCM from a PFI car and does same thing. Got another ECM from 88 4.5 deville.....runs worse. I cant find any 89 caddies...almost none have computers..

I made a video of how the car runs etc, i don't have alot of time to screw with it, so if you Gentlemen could shine some light on this car I would really appreciate it. The car ran like this with original bcm. Part numbers for BCM are different on rockauto for 89, 90-93 is the same.


89 was the 4.5 PFI engine. Prior years had the 4.5 TBI so wouldnt expect it to work well. 4.9 would probably run poorly due to rich mixture, surprised it even works honestly.

Lack of comms might be the BCM complaining about the ECM version. I would NOT recommend changing ECM as it talks to everything else (injectors, everything engine related). My advice is get on ebay. Also check car-part.com for junkyards that might have. I found a couple of BCMs for $25ish IIRC

Ehall, PFI came in 90 4.5, then 91-93 was 4.9. This car is TBI, my caddy is PFI (91). So what youre saying is I should install 89 TBI BCM? What would be the differences between 89 BCM and 90 thru 93 BCM's? They look the same but numbers are different between 89 and 90-93.

ah you're right, 88 and 89 were TBI, sorry about that

I would stick to the model years. The BCM controls a lot of crap.

Yeah the original BCM doesnt power up the fuel/climate/cluster. But the car runs the same with original bcm or the 90-93 bcm..

What about tps, Coolant temp and MAT sensors if they went bad? While BCM throws F15 and F32 codes, it doesnt show any E codes, is it because of the communication issue?

the BCM only does F codes, the ECM does the E codes